Full Description

Attached cottage, premises of W J Ferry. Early C19. Rubble-stone walls. Slate roof. C20 brick stacks, left of centre on party ridge, and at right hand gable. 2 storeys. 2 windows, 3-light C20 wooden casements. Front door at centre, plank with a wooden frame and wooden lintel over. Shop premises in left hand room. Attached house at right angles in Back Street, same materials, storeys. 2 windows, wooden casements with glazing-bars. Wooden lintels over. C19 plank door at centre, with a wooden lintel over. This description includes No 2 Back Street, (qv).
